Understanding Energy Consumption in Water Coolers
Excessive energy consumption often relates to the design and efficiency of the water cooler itself. According to James O’Connor, a senior analyst at Energy Star, “The efficiency of a water cooler can vary significantly between models. Older units tend to have less efficient compressors and fans, leading to unnecessary energy use.” Hence, organizations utilizing outdated coolers should consider modern, energy-efficient alternatives.
The Role of Regular Maintenance
Regular maintenance can play a pivotal role in ensuring your water cooler operates efficiently. Linda Chang, a maintenance expert at AquaTech, notes, “A poorly maintained cooler can consume up to 30% more energy than a well-maintained one. Simple actions like cleaning filters and checking seals can make a big difference.”
Identifying Signs of Inefficiency
But how can businesses identify if their water coolers are consuming excessive energy? Mark Thompson, a consultant for industrial water cooler manufacturers, explains, “Look for signs like high electricity bills, unusual noises, or warm water dispensed. These could be indicators that your cooler is not functioning optimally.”
Energy-Efficient Alternatives
Switching to more energy-efficient models can significantly reduce electricity costs. Sarah Lewis, an environmental scientist, emphasizes, “Investing in ENERGY STAR certified water coolers not only reduces energy consumption but also provides a return on investment through lower utility bills.”

Tips for Reducing Energy Costs
Several strategies can help organizations minimize energy costs associated with their water coolers. Here are some recommendations:
- Upgrade to energy-efficient models from leading industrial water cooler manufacturers.
- Implement regular maintenance schedules to ensure optimal performance.
- Educate employees on the proper usage of water coolers.
- Monitor energy consumption and evaluate the effectiveness of your water cooler regularly.
